Backflow Preventer Testing for Missouri Irrigation Systems

Backflow preventers are vital components within irrigation systems, designed specifically to protect potable water supplies from contamination or pollution due to backflow. This contamination can occur when there is a sudden change in pressure within the plumbing system, pushing potentially contaminated water backward into the potable water supply.
